  • CV axles are a modern drivetrain component commonly found on all front wheel drive vehicles. They serve the purpose of transferring the power from the vehicle’s transmission and differential to the wheels so that they can propel the vehicle forward. They have a greased flexible joint that allows the axle to flex according to the road conditions The joint is lubricated with grease and covered in a rubber boot to protect it from dirt and debris. Because the CV axles are the direct link that transfers the power of the engine to the wheels, they are subject to high amounts of stress over time and will eventually wear out and require replacement. When they do wear out, CV axles usually will produce a few symptoms that can alert the driver that they require attention One of the most common and most noticeable symptoms of a bad or failing CV axle shaft assembly is an audible clicking noise when turning. When CV axles become excessively worn, the joints will become loose and click when turning. The clicks may become louder or more pronounced during sharper and faster turns, and will be heard on the side with the faulty CV shaft Another symptom of a problem with the CV axle shafts is grease on the insde edge of the tire or along the undersides of the vehicle. This is usually caused by a torn boot leaking grease, and it being tossed around while the axle turns. A leaky boot will eventually lead to CV joint failure, as dirt and debris will get into the boot and damage the joint If a CV joint or axle shaft is damaged in any way that affects its balance while rotating, it will cause the shaft to vibrate excessively while operating the vehicle. The vibrations may oscillate in speed, or become more pronounced as vehicle speed increases. Excessively vibrating CV shafts can interfere with the handling and ride characteristics, and to the overall safety and comfort of the vehicle. Usually the CV axle will need to be replaced if it is damaged enough to cause vibrations
